What the college says
This hands-on, industry-aligned qualification is your gateway into the world of automotive service and repair. Developed in collaboration with employers and technical experts, the City & Guilds Level 2 Diploma is designed to equip you with the essential knowledge, skills, and behaviours needed to begin a successful career as a Light Vehicle Service and Maintenance Technician. Whether youre passionate about cars, enjoy problem-solving, or want to work in a fast-paced, evolving industry, this course offers the perfect foundation. Throughout the course, you’ll gain a strong understanding of: Vehicle systems and components (engine, transmission, brakes, suspension, etc.) Routine maintenance and servicing procedures Diagnosis and repair of mechanical and electrical faults Health, safety, and sustainability in the automotive environment Customer service and workplace professionalismYou will need to purchase the PPE pack which includes overalls, polo shirts and work trousers. You will also need steel toe cap footwear. All MidKent College students will continue studying English and maths until they are 19, or until they have achieved a Grade C/4. Your study programme will incorporate a work placement of up to 350 hours in a role relevant to your study. All students will have access to a personal tutor to support their personal and professional development.
What you need to get on
Minimum of 4 GCSEs at grade 3 (D) or above, including English and maths A genuine interest in the motor vehicle industry A successful interview and initial assessment to determine suitability If you don’t meet the entry criteria, we may offer you a place on a relevant Level 1 course to help you progress.
